The authors prove the following result: If a graph \(G\) decomposes into two paths \(X\) and \(Y\), each of length \(n\) with \(n\geq 2\), and \(X\) and \(Y\) have at least one common vertex, then \(G\) has a path of length \(n\) distinct from \(X\) and \(Y\).
